Monday – Friday (40 hours). 20 days' holiday plus 8 bank holidays. Free onsite parking, gym membership, and uniform provided.

Responsibilities

  • Collect and transport waste materials from designated areas to disposal sites.
  • Operate waste collection vehicles safely, adhering to all traffic regulations.
  • Replenish consumables and stock within the buildings.
  • Assist with laundry cleaning duties.
  • Assist with special cleaning projects as required.
  • Maintain a clean and organised work environment.
  • Follow health and safety regulations at all times.
  • Collaborate with team members to deliver excellent service.
  • Report any maintenance or safety issues promptly.
  • Support other janitorial tasks as required.

Qualifications

  • Experience with manual handling and comfortable working indoors and outdoors.
  • Positive, helpful, and flexible approach with the ability to adapt to changing tasks.
  • Reliable, punctual, and take pride in work.
  • A full UK driving licence held for at least 12 months and reliable transport to site.
  • Experience working in a corporate environment is preferred.

How to prepare for a job interview at ISS

Know Your Responsibilities

Familiarise yourself with the job description and responsibilities. Be ready to discuss how your past experiences align with tasks like waste collection, maintaining cleanliness, and collaborating with team members.

Showcase Your Flexibility

Highlight your ability to adapt to changing tasks. Share examples from previous jobs where you successfully handled unexpected challenges or took on additional duties, demonstrating your positive and helpful approach.

Emphasise Safety Awareness

Since health and safety regulations are crucial in this role, be prepared to talk about your understanding of these regulations. Mention any relevant training or experiences that showcase your commitment to maintaining a safe work environment.

Prepare Questions

Have a few thoughtful questions ready for the interviewer. This could be about the team dynamics, specific cleaning projects, or opportunities for career advancement. It shows your genuine interest in the role and the company.
